Site Plan
536 Main St
Applicant: HRSM LLC
Taylor Palmer and Aryeh Siegel presented refinements to building, green space, landscaping, and ARB-recommended changes. Board discussed trim, awnings, brick details, fence location, and rock outcroppings on Conklin Street. Motion to direct preparation of draft negative declaration approved 6-0. Motion to schedule public hearing for March 14, 2023 approved 6-0.

- Exhibit B - Full EAF - 536 Main Street (opens in a new tab)
17 pages · 1.7 MB
This Full Environmental Assessment Form (EAF) Part 1 documents a proposed 3-story commercial development at 536 Main Street in Beacon, NY, including its anticipated environmental impacts related to water, wastewater, stormwater, air emissions, traffic, and waste management. The form indicates that the project site is in a historic district overlay zone, requires several government approvals including site plan review and building permits, and is proximate to a DEC-listed remediation site (Churchill Mills) classified as "No Further Action at this Time" and potential endangered species habitat (Indiana Bat).

- Exhibit D - Traffic and Parking Study prepared by DTS Provident Design Engineering dated January 31 2023 (opens in a new tab)
7 pages · 912 KB
This traffic and parking study, prepared by DTS Provident Design Engineering for a proposed 3-story commercial development (furniture store with 12,594 square feet) at 536 Main Street in Beacon, NY, concludes that the project will generate minimal traffic (4-7 trips during peak hours) with no adverse impacts on the surrounding roadway network. A parking survey conducted within an 800-foot radius identified 375 total parking spaces with 50 available spaces during peak demand (1:00-1:30 PM on Sunday), providing more than adequate parking to support the project and justify a waiver of off-street parking requirements under City Code provisions.

- Planners Comments 536 Main St 2.10.23 (opens in a new tab)
2 pages · 116 KB
This February 10, 2023 planner's review of the 536 Main Street site plan proposal identifies inconsistencies in building square footage documentation, requests additional details on the Traffic and Parking Study including employee counts and parking survey methodologies, and provides specific recommendations regarding zoning setback calculations, landscaping documentation, architectural design review, and compliance with lighting standards. The proposed 3-story building with 12,594 square feet of retail space in the Central Main Street and Historic District overlay requires revisions and Architectural Review Subcommittee evaluation before approval.

- Traffic Comments 536 Main Street Review 1 (opens in a new tab)
2 pages · 277 KB
This is Creighton Manning Engineering's first technical review of the site plan and traffic impact study for a proposed 12,594-square-foot three-story commercial building (furniture store) at 536 Main Street in Beacon, NY, prepared on February 13, 2023. The review generally agrees with the traffic study methodology and trip generation calculations but identifies several issues requiring clarification or revision, including discrepancies in the parking study period timing, the need to coordinate parking analysis with other pending projects, validation of area-wide parking supply, and recommendations to conduct parking utilization studies across multiple seasons and days of the week.
